//! Type of the decoding algorithm |
|
// other algorithms can be implemented |
|
enum |
|
{ |
|
DECODE_3D_UNDERWORLD = 0 //!< Kyriakos Herakleous, Charalambos Poullis. "3DUNDERWORLD-SLS: An Open-Source Structured-Light Scanning System for Rapid Geometry Acquisition", arXiv preprint arXiv:1406.6595 (2014). |
|
}; |
|
|
|
/** @brief Abstract base class for generating and decoding structured light patterns. |
|
*/ |
|
class CV_EXPORTS_W StructuredLightPattern : public virtual Algorithm |
|
{ |
|
public: |
|
/** @brief Generates the structured light pattern to project. |
|
|
|
@param patternImages The generated pattern: a vector<Mat>, in which each image is a CV_8U Mat at projector's resolution. |
|
*/ |
|
CV_WRAP |
|
virtual bool generate( OutputArrayOfArrays patternImages ) = 0; |
|
|
|
/** @brief Decodes the structured light pattern, generating a disparity map |
|
|
|
@param patternImages The acquired pattern images to decode (vector<vector<Mat>>), loaded as grayscale and previously rectified. |
|
@param disparityMap The decoding result: a CV_64F Mat at image resolution, storing the computed disparity map. |
|
@param blackImages The all-black images needed for shadowMasks computation. |
|
@param whiteImages The all-white images needed for shadowMasks computation. |
|
@param flags Flags setting decoding algorithms. Default: DECODE_3D_UNDERWORLD. |
|
@note All the images must be at the same resolution. |
|
*/ |
|
CV_WRAP |
|
virtual bool decode( const std::vector< std::vector<Mat> >& patternImages, OutputArray disparityMap, |
|
InputArrayOfArrays blackImages = noArray(), |
|
InputArrayOfArrays whiteImages = noArray(), |
|
int flags = DECODE_3D_UNDERWORLD ) const = 0; |
|
}; |
